Η Εξέλιξη των Asynchronous Programming στη Σύγχρονη Εξυπηρέτηση Λογισμικού

Οι σύγχρονες απαιτήσεις για αμεσότητα και αποδοτικότητα στο ψηφιακό περιβάλλον έχουν αναδείξει την ανάγκη για μεγαλύτερη αποτελεσματικότητα στον τρόπο διαχείρισης ασύγχρονων λειτουργιών. Οι καινοτομίες όπως οι async και await έχουν διαμορφώσει μια νέα γενιά τεχνικών στον χώρο του προγραμματισμού, επιτρέποντας την ευκολότερη ανάπτυξη εφαρμογών που ανταποκρίνονται ταχύτερα και αποδοτικότερα στις απαιτήσεις των χρηστών.

Η σημασία του Ελέγχου Ροής στη Σύγχρονη Ανάπτυξη Λογισμικού

Η διαχείριση των ασύγχρονων διαδικασιών αποτελεί κρίσιμο πυλώνα στην ανάπτυξη λογισμικού, ειδικά σε εφαρμογές που βασίζονται σε δεδομένα πραγματικού χρόνου ή απαιτούν υψηλές επιδόσεις. Παραδοσιακά, η πολυπλοκότητα έγκειται στην εύρεση εύκολων τρόπων για την ανάμειξη πολλαπλών ασύγχρονων λειτουργιών χωρίς να χαθεί η διαφάνεια στον κώδικα.

“Η χρήση async και await επιτρέπει την ανάπτυξη κώδικα που μοιάζει απόλυτα με τον συγχρονικό, αλλά στην πραγματικότητα εκτελείται ασύγχρονα, διασφαλίζοντας ταχύτερη απόκριση και καλύτερη διαχείριση πόρων.”

Εσωτερική ανάλυση και εξειδίκευση: Πώς λειτουργούν τα async και await

Οι async functions ενεργοποιούν μια ασύγχρονη διαδικασία, ενώ η χρήση await επιτρέπει την παύση της εκτέλεσης μέχρι την ολοκλήρωση μιας υπόσχεσης (promise). Αυτό εξαλείφει την ανάγκη για περίπλοκες ανώνυμες κλάσεις και callback, καθιστώντας τον κώδικα περισσότερο κατανοητό και εύκολα διαχειρίσιμο.

Συγχρηματοδότηση και Επόμενα Βήματα στην Ελλάδα

Παρά το γεγονός ότι η τεχνική αυτή είναι καλά εδραιωμένη στις αγγλόφωνες αγορές, η υιοθέτησή της στην ελληνική κοινότητα προγραμματισμού επιταχύνεται. Εκπαιδευτικά ιδρύματα, εταιρείες και ανεξάρτητοι επαγγελματίες αναζητούν ολοκληρωμένους οδηγούς και πηγές γνώσης. Στο πλαίσιο αυτό, η επίσημη σελίδα λειτουργεί ως ανεκτίμητη πηγή ενημέρωσης, προσφέροντας δομημένα μαθήματα, άρθρα και online σεμινάρια που καλύπτουν τις τελευταίες πρακτικές και εργαλεία στην ελληνική γλώσσα.

Δεδομένα και τάσεις στη διεθνή αγορά

Παραμέτρους Τιμές / Πληροφορίες
Ποσοστό ανάπτυξης χρήσης async/await Αύξηση κατά 47% από το 2019 έως το 2023 (Γκουγκλ Αναλύσεις, 2023)
Κορυφαίες τεχνολογίες υιοθέτησης Node.js, C#, Python, JavaScript Frameworks
Οδηγός εκπαιδεύσεων στην Ελλάδα Αυξητική τάση 20% ετησίως, με σημαντική εισροή από την επίσημη σελίδα

Ο ρόλος της εκπαίδευσης και της κοινότητας

Οι επαγγελματίες και φοιτητές στην Ελλάδα αναζητούν πρακτικές λύσεις και επίσημες πηγές για να εμπλουτίσουν τις γνώσεις τους. Με τη βοήθεια αξιόπιστων πόρων όπως η επίσημη σελίδα, το ελληνικό κοινό μπορεί να αναπτύξει δεξιότητες που θα το καταστήσουν ανταγωνιστικό στην παγκόσμια αγορά.

Συμπέρασμα

Καθώς η τεχνητή νοημοσύνη, το cloud computing και οι πραγματικοί χρόνοι συνεχίζουν να διαμορφώνουν το τοπίο του ψηφιακού κόσμου, η κατανόηση και η αξιοποίηση τεχνικών όπως τα async και await καθίσταται ζωτικής σημασίας. Η πρόσβαση σε αξιόπιστες, επίσημες πηγές όπως η επίσημη σελίδα αποτελεί κρίσιμο εργαλείο για την ενδυνάμωση των προγραμματιστών και των οργανισμών στην Ελλάδα, ώστε να διασφαλίσουν ότι η τεχνολογία υπηρετεί τους στόχους τους αποτελεσματικά και με ασφάλεια.

發佈留言

發佈留言必須填寫的電子郵件地址不會公開。 必填欄位標示為 *

Scroll to Top